After his first 6G White book published in 2020, Samsung released another updated white book containing new developments in this area. The company plans to integrate artificial intelligence (YZ) technologies into the 6G system in order to improve telecommunications infrastructure and to adapt to the connection technologies of the future. This integration is expected to increase network quality as well as energy efficiency and make user experience more sustainable.
White books are often known as technical documents in which a company or institution details their future plans on a particular technology or strategy. Samsung’s new white book reveals how the 6G will improve the connection, accelerate and differentiate from the existing 5G technology. The company states that five main services will greatly benefit from 6G technology:
- Immersive XR (Expanded Reality): It will combine virtual and real worlds in the fields of entertainment, health and science to make user experiences more interactive and immersive.
- Digital Twin Technology: It will make the creation of virtual copies of physical assets and make security, remote monitoring and analysis processes more efficient. For example, real -time data flow can be achieved with virtual holograms.
- MASIF CONTACT: A large number of sensors will be connected to the network of the machine and the terminal, and will offer more reliable and uninterrupted connections in smart cities, houses and industrial automation systems.
- Ubiquitous Connectivity everywhere: It aims to provide a wider area of coverage by increasing the interaction between terrestrial and non -terrestrial (eg satellite) networks.
- Fixed wireless access (FWA): It will offer high -speed internet access, such as wired connections, but it will do it through a completely wireless system.
Samsung aims to optimize the user experience, to facilitate network management and to increase operational efficiency by strengthening all of these services with artificial intelligence -supported systems.
According to Samsung’s plans, artificial intelligence will not only increase the performance of 6G, but will also help to manage network operations more efficiently. Thanks to the advanced data analytics offered by YZ, network traffic will be directed smarter and significant improvements in connection quality will be provided.
In addition, the impact of artificial intelligence on energy efficiency will be great. High energy consumption in telecommunications infrastructure increases costs and brings environmental effects. However, it is aimed to minimize the energy consumption of 6G and to create a sustainable network infrastructure with artificial intelligence -supported optimizations.
2030 is pointed out for the completion of Samsung 6G standards
According to the information contained in Samsung’s new White book, the development of 6G technology will continue to accelerate. The company expects the 6G standards to be completed as of 2030. In this process, it is stated that research and development will be accelerated and cooperation with other major players in the sector will be increased.
